History of World Tourism Day

World Tourism Day, celebrated on September 27th each year, was established by the United Nations World Tourism Organization (UNWTO) in 1980. The date was chosen to commemorate the adoption of the UNWTO Statutes on September 27, 1970, a milestone in global tourism.

The creation of this day was driven by the desire to promote awareness of the vital role tourism plays in fostering sustainable development, economic growth, and cultural exchange. It was envisioned as a platform to highlight tourism’s contributions to job creation, infrastructure development, and the preservation of cultural heritage.

Significance of World Tourism Day

World Tourism Day holds immense significance for several reasons:

Promoting Global Awareness

This day serves as a global observance to raise awareness about the social, cultural, economic, and environmental benefits of tourism. It encourages people worldwide to appreciate the positive impact of tourism on both host communities and travelers.

Fostering Sustainable Tourism

Sustainability is at the core of World Tourism Day’s message. It calls for responsible and sustainable tourism practices that respect local cultures, preserve natural resources, and contribute to the well-being of host destinations.

Celebrating Cultural Diversity

Tourism promotes cultural exchange and understanding among people from diverse backgrounds. It celebrates the unique traditions, cuisines, art, and heritage of each destination, fostering respect and tolerance.

Economic Empowerment

Tourism is a significant economic driver, providing livelihoods to millions of people worldwide. World Tourism Day recognizes the importance of the tourism industry in creating jobs and generating income, especially in developing regions.

Strengthening International Cooperation

The day encourages countries to work together to improve travel infrastructure, enhance safety, and facilitate seamless travel experiences. It highlights the importance of international cooperation in making tourism accessible and enjoyable for all.

Showcasing Hidden Gems

World Tourism Day often focuses on lesser-known destinations, shedding light on hidden gems and encouraging travelers to explore beyond the beaten path. This diversifies tourism and distributes its benefits more evenly.

Inspiring Responsible Travel

Tourists are encouraged to be responsible travelers, respecting local customs, supporting sustainable businesses, and minimizing their environmental footprint. World Tourism Day promotes the idea that travel can be a force for good.

Embracing Innovation

The tourism industry continually evolves with technological advancements and changing traveler preferences. World Tourism Day encourages innovation and the adoption of digital tools to enhance travel experiences.
